Single-player carney games are ALWAYS a scam.
Ball toss into basket: you need to put more energy into the ball to get it to
reach the basket than it takes for the ball to bounce/roll back out of the
basket.
Darts: dull enough to bounce off balloons

I figure a rusty but driveable car is always worth $1500.
One bad caliper means new front brakes. Calipers, rotors, pads and hoses.
Figure on $300 in parts and an afternoon (for me anyway). Slave cylinder is a
PITA but not really that hard. Q2 doesn't list one but the same year 240D is
The rocker panel rust is the deal killer. This is so insidious on a 123 chassis
it's not funny. There is no band-aid repair you can do that will restore the
integrity of this area, as there are several layers of metal, all of which have
to be addressed.
